Kylie Jenner and her sister, Kendall, were nowhere to be seen when their half-bother, Brody, got hitched on the weekend. Brody, 41, whose shares the same dad as the lip kit mogul and model – Caitlyn Jenner – tied the knot in a intimate ceremony under the Malibu sun at his mother Linda Thompson’s home, surrounded by loved ones.

Kris Jenner’s ex, Caitlyn, 75, was at the wedding, as were Brody’s brothers, Brandon and Burt, however, Kylie, 27, and Kendall, 29, decided to swerve the occasion after reports they didn’t RSVP to Brody’s commitment ceremony in Bali with his then girlfriend, Kaitlynn Carter, in 2018.

Despite skipping the wedding in California, a source talking to TMZ claims there is no bad blood, but “mutual love” between the Jenners sisters and Brody, suggesting Kylie and Kendall may have swerved the event “to keep the spotlight on the bride and groom”.

As two of the world’s most recognisable faces, with millions of followers on social media, they certainly would have made sure all eyes were on them had they rocked up at the nuptials.

However, Brody has admitted that he is not close to his superstar siblings as he insisted it’s “no-one’s fault”. In January, the Hills alum revealed that the Kardashian-Jenner siblings—including his youngest sisters don’t gather all that often. But not because of any bad blood.

“I love ‘em all,” Brody told Nick Viall on the The Viall Files podcast. “Love ‘em all to death. I just don’t see them.”

Brody, who shares daughter Honey, two, with new wife, Tia, explained that he doesn’t live far from his half-siblings, but pointed out that they “lived in two different households growing up”.

He explained: “We all have a tremendous amount of love for each other, even Kendall and Kylie,” he continued. “It’s not their fault, it’s not my fault, it’s not really anybody’s fault. It’s just, yeah, they don’t live that far, but we lived in two different households growing up.”

And although Brody said he and his sisters aren’t “call-each-other-every-day type of close,” he would still show up for them if they needed him.

“If Kylie or Kendall call me right now, I would walk out of this room and pick up the phone,” he said, “and I’d be there for them.”

Kylie quietly confirmed her absence from Brody’s big day on the weekend by sharing holiday snaps from a yacht in Greece, including a video of her larking about in a robe and towel with her daughter, Stormi, seven.

However, she and Kendall did attend Jeff Bezos’ wedding last month in Venice, where they rubbed shoulders with the toast of the tech world and Hollywood.

Their father, Caitlyn did attend Brody’s wedding despite their strained relationship over the years.

The Special Forces: World’s Toughest Test star shared earlier this year that he received a “real, sincere apology” from Caitlyn after feeling neglected amid the Olympian’s growing fame with the Kardashians.

“It was the first time in my life that I’ve ever gotten an apology,” Brody said on the competition series in January, adding Caitlyn said: “You know, ‘I’m sorry for not being there.’”
